FWIS 179 - LITERATURE OF ENVIRONMENTALISM

Long Title: AMERICAN LITERATURE IN THE ERA OF ENVIRONMENTALISM
Department: First-Year Writing Intensive
Grade Mode: Standard Letter
Course Type: Seminar
Distribution Group: Distribution Group I
Credit Hours: 3
Description: What is environmental literature? This course will explore this question by examining major trends shaping how American writers have understood and written about their environments historically, and how those trends continue to influence our feelings towards the environment. Texts include Rachel Carson's Silent Spring and Jon Krakauer's Into the Wild.
